Abstract

The invention relates to a phosphine-free scale inhibition dispersion agent which is prepared by components, by weight, of 15-20 parts of sodium gluconate, 5-8 parts of benzotriazole, 20-30 parts of p-aminobenzene sulfonic acid anilino polyepoxysuccinic acid, 10-15 parts of sodium lignin sulfonate, 10-15 parts of reverse osmosis scale inhibition dispersion agent and 20-30 parts of water.According to the phosphine-free scale inhibition dispersion agent, the sodium gluconate, the benzotriazole, the p-aminobenzene sulfonic acid anilino polyepoxysuccinic acid, the odium lignin sulfonate, the reverse osmosis scale inhibition dispersion agent and the water are mixed, the scale inhibition and dispersion effects are effectively improved, and the scale inhibition effect is improved remarkably.The scale inhibition range is expanded, the scale inhibition performance on calcium carbonate, calcium sulfate and barium sulfate is improved to different extents, and the phosphine-free scale inhibition dispersion agent has excellent zinc scale inhibition characteristic and excellent corrosion inhibition performance.

Further, a preferred embodiment of the present invention: described p-sulfonic acid anilino-polycyclic oxygen amber The preparation method of amber acid, comprises the following steps:
The first step, raw material maleic anhydride is dissolved in deionized water, and at ice bath and stirring bar Drip the sodium hydroxide solution of 50% under part, make maleic anhydride hydrolyze and be changed into maleic acid Sodium salt, the rate of addition controlling NaOH makes reaction temperature be not higher than 70 DEG C;
Second step, in 50~60 DEG C of water-baths, in solution add 30% hydrogen peroxide, with tungsten Acid sodium is catalyst, carries out the epoxidation reaction of maleate, and reaction temperature is 60~70 DEG C, Reaction time is 1~3 hour, and the alkaline aqueous solution of dropping adjusts the pH value of mixed liquor to be 6~7, Obtain Epoxysuccinic acid;
After 3rd step, epoxidation reaction without isolation, it is directly added into para-anilinesulfonic acid, React 2~4 hours under conditions of pH7~8;
4th step, rise to 80~90 DEG C by the 3rd step obtains mixture temperature, add hydroxide Calcium directly carries out polymerisation, and the reaction time is 2~5 hours, obtains faint yellow viscous shape liquid, It is the poly-epoxy succinic acid p-sulfonic acid anilino-polyepoxy sodium succinate of para-anilinesulfonic acid.
Further, a preferred embodiment of the present invention: in the described first step, NaOH adds Entering amount is: maleic anhydride and mol ratio=1:1.2~1:1.6 of NaOH.
Further, a preferred embodiment of the present invention: it is characterized in that: in described second step The addition of hydrogen peroxide be: mol ratio=1:1.1~1:1.2 of maleic anhydride and hydrogen peroxide, tungsten The addition of acid sodium is: maleic anhydride and mol ratio=1:0.005~1:0.02 of sodium tungstate.
Further, a preferred embodiment of the present invention: in the 3rd described step to amido benzene sulphur The addition of acid is: maleic anhydride and mol ratio=1:0.01~1:0.1 of para-anilinesulfonic acid.
Further, a preferred embodiment of the present invention: the described oxygen calcium oxide in the 4th step Addition is: maleic anhydride and mol ratio=1:0.08~1:0.23 of calcium hydroxide.

Embodiment 1
A kind of without phosphine dirt dispersion agent, in parts by weight, including sodium gluconate 15 parts, BTA 5 parts, p-sulfonic acid anilino-poly-epoxy succinic acid 25 parts, sodium lignin sulfonate 13 parts, counter-infiltration dirt dispersion agent 15 parts and 27 parts of water.
The preparation method of described p-sulfonic acid anilino-poly-epoxy succinic acid:
To the four necks burnings being furnished with stirring condenser pipe, stirring, thermometer, pH meter, dropping funel Add 49.00g (0.50mol) maleic anhydride in Ping, and add the dissolving of 50ml water, in stirring Under be slowly added dropwise 50% sodium hydrate aqueous solution 55g, control solution temperature be not higher than 70 DEG C. Then heat in the water-bath of 60 DEG C~65 DEG C, when temperature rises to 50 DEG C~60 DEG C, add 1.85g (0.006mol) catalyst sodium tungstate also stirs.Then dividing 5 times and adding total amount is 65.50g The epoxidizing agent hydrogen peroxide (0.578mol) of 30%, added once every 30 minutes, adds every time After hydrogen peroxide, by dropping 50% sodium hydrate aqueous solution maintain reactant liquor pH be 6~ 7, the most epoxidised temperature maintains 60 DEG C~65 DEG C, hydrogen peroxide all add after at 60 DEG C ~at a temperature of 65 DEG C, add 4.33g (0.025mol) para-anilinesulfonic acid continuation reaction 3 hours, The pH of reactant liquor is maintained to be 7~8 by the sodium hydrate aqueous solution of dropping 50%;Again by temperature Rise to 90 DEG C, add 3.7g (0.05mol) calcium hydroxide, react 2.0 hours, obtain necessarily The poly-epoxy succinic acid that the flaxen viscous shape liquid of solid content, i.e. para-anilinesulfonic acid are modified P-sulfonic acid anilino-poly-epoxy succinic acid.
